The short answer, my friend, is a little nuanced. While your nose itself, the actual bony and cartilaginous structure, doesn't shrink in the same way that fat cells in other parts of your body do, the appearance of your nose can definitely change as you lose weight. Think of it like this: imagine a sculpture. If you start to chip away the clay from around the base and sides, the central form might look more prominent, right? Your nose is kind of the central form!
So, what’s going on here? Well, our faces have a layer of subcutaneous fat, that lovely little cushion that gives our features softness. When you lose weight, you’re reducing this fat layer all over your body, and that includes your face. Areas that might have been a bit fuller, like your cheeks and the sides of your nose, can become more defined. This increased definition can make your nose appear more sculpted and, yes, potentially seemingly smaller or at least more prominent in relation to a slimmer face.
It's all about proportions, darling! When your cheeks are fuller, they can sort of visually broaden the base of your nose, making it look wider or less distinct. As those cheeks slim down, your nose gets a chance to stand out more, like a star performer taking center stage!

Have you ever seen those incredible before-and-after photos of people who've undergone significant weight transformations? Beyond the obvious changes in their waistlines and arms, you'll often notice a dramatic shift in their facial features. Their cheekbones become more pronounced, their jawlines sharpen, and yes, their noses can appear more refined. It’s not that the bone structure changed, but the surrounding soft tissue did.

It’s also important to remember that everyone’s facial structure is unique. Some people might notice a significant difference in their nose’s appearance with weight loss, while others might see only a very subtle change. Genetics plays a big role, of course! The shape and size of your nose are largely determined by your bone and cartilage structure, which are pretty much set in stone (or cartilage, as it were).
